His acts are mostly legendary. He was educated at Bangor  under Saint Comgall . In 616  he founded the Church and Abbey  of Balla of which he became the first abbot -bishop . Numerous miracles are attributed to him. Feast , 30 March . <\/p>\n<h4 align='right'><i><b>Fuente: New Catholic Dictionary<\/b><\/i><\/h4>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Monchua, Cronan, Saint Confessor , died 637 , founder of the See of Balla, Ireland .
